I read that Joyent is working on extending SmartOS/SDC with network
virtualization based on VXLAN. I assume that in addition to a kernel
module for VXLAN interfaces there will be some control plane /
orchestration layer that works together with SDC.

Is there some architecture documentation available that would explain 
the big picture? How is the overlay network supposed to work?
Just plain basic MAC learning, or something more advanced with
an actual control plane (BGP?) like in Juniper Contrail or Alcatel
Nuage?

Will use cases like service chaining be supported?

Is a current (2015, with lxbrand) binary build available for testing?
The latest bits I could find are almost 5 month old.
